4.1 申请证书
- 通过服务器供应商免费申请SSL证书,博主用的腾讯云
- 获得.crt&.key文件
- 如果是其他格式证书文件 ( 如 pem ) , 可将证书上传至腾讯云再 重新下载 , 即可得到各种格式的证书文件 腾讯云证书管理
4.2 修改 nginx.conf 文件
- 修改 第三阶段Nginx部署 中修改过的 nginx.conf 文件 ( 主要更改http部分 )
- 需要更改 内容如下
http {
include mime.types;
default_type application/octet-stream;
sendfile on;
keepalive_timeout 65;
server {
listen 80;
listen 443 ssl;
server_name localhost;
charset utf-8;
ssl_certificate /home/ubuntu/sms02/1_www.wrhan.cn_bundle.crt;
ssl_certificate_key /home/ubuntu/sms02/2_www.wrhan.cn.key;
location / {
include uwsgi_params;
uwsgi_connect_timeout 30;
uwsgi_pass unix:/home/ubuntu/sms02/uwsgi.sock;
index index.html index.htm;
client_max_body_size 75M;
}
}
}
sudo service nginx restart
- 正常运行后 , 浏览器输入你的域名 ( https) 进行测试
>>点击返回导航目录<<